Singer came into their game on Friday off a hard-fought close win, but unfortunately suffered a serious change of fortune. They lost 19-4 to Plainview.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against Plainview this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 8-3 on March 1st.
Singer's defeat dropped their record down to 2-8. As for Plainview, the victory (which was their fourth in a row) raised their record to 9-9.
Coming up, Singer will look to defend their home field on Saturday against Starks at 1:00 p.m. Starks has struggled to contain batters this season (they've allowed 12.3 runs per game on average), something Singer will no doubt try to take advantage of. As for Plainview, they will square off against Simpson on Monday.
